The Compare tool lets you view two or more books side by side using objective measures from the catalog. You can see how word count, reading time, and sentence length differ, which may inform your choice.
Comparison is about fit, not quality. A short, dense text may suit a deep dive, while a longer, simpler one might be better for casual reading. The numbers help you anticipate the experience.
Word counts and reading minutes give a sense of scale. A 3,000-word essay can be read in a quarter hour, while a 100,000-word work may take days.
Average sentence length in words hints at style. Shorter sentences are often more direct; longer ones can be more intricate. See how authors differ.
Text sections indicate how a book is organized. More sections may mean clearer breaks, while fewer sections might suggest a continuous narrative.

A genuine side-by-side example illustrates the value. Consider On the History of Gunter's Scale and the Slide Rule During the Seventeenth Century — Themes and Context (id 238) and An Elementary Course in Synthetic Projective Geometry — A Reader’s Guide (id 226). The former is a 17,019-word historical account with 3 text sections and an average sentence length of 20.2 words; the latter is a 36,371-word textbook with 12 sections and an average sentence of 21.2 words. The differences in length and section count suggest very different reading experiences.
The most immediate difference between the two books is length. On the History of Gunter's Scale (id 238) is about 17,000 words, which at an average reading speed translates to roughly 74 minutes. An Elementary Course in Synthetic Projective Geometry (id 226) is more than twice as long, at 36,371 words and an estimated 159 minutes. If you have a single sitting available, the former is a realistic choice; the latter demands a longer commitment or multiple sessions.
The compare tool also shows text sections, which can be a proxy for how the content is organized. The slide rule history has only 3 sections, meaning the narrative likely flows in long, uninterrupted chapters. The projective geometry text has 12 sections, suggesting a more modular structure with distinct topics or exercises. A reader who prefers to pause frequently might find the 12-section book easier to navigate, while a reader who likes to sink into a continuous argument might prefer the 3-section approach.
Estimated reading time is calculated from the catalog's word counts and a standard reading speed, so it is an approximation. Still, the difference between 74 and 159 minutes is substantial enough to influence a decision. If your available time is closer to two hours, the projective geometry book might fit, but the slide rule history would leave you with time to spare.
Sentence flow, measured as average words per sentence, is 20.2 for the slide rule history and 21.2 for the projective geometry text. The difference is small, but it hints at a slightly more complex sentence structure in the latter. Neither is extreme; the catalog includes books with averages as low as 12.2 words (A Review of Algebra, id 237) and as high as 33.4 words (The Fibonacci Number Series, id 217). If you find long sentences taxing, a lower average might be more comfortable.
